"In an effort to support U.S. Air Force space community resilience objectives, researchers conducted a review of the academic literature defining and describing resiliency in various domains, and case-study reports about how organizations build resilient missions. This report summarizes key findings from this review that have broad application to any organization seeking to enhance resilience, which includes the space community. This report presents the approaches taken by three different types of communities to develop and maintain resilient operations. The discussion presented in this report illustrates three methods for building resilience, each illustrated by the approach of one community; resilience through withstanding an adverse event (impact avoidance and robustness), resilience through adaptation and flexibility, and resilience through recovery and restoration. These approaches are broadly described in this report as: withstand, adapt, and recover. Communities seeking to develop more resilient operations can gain insight from applying the various methods described in the literature, and applying lessons derived from similar operational environments and how they addressed resilience. Recognizing that any given organization can incorporate all three of these approaches in various parts of an overall resilience plan, this report seeks to highlight organizations that will be most likely to emphasize one of these approaches over another"--Publisher's description.

To help the National Reconnaissance Office (NRO) become more flexible and agile in an increasingly uncertain world, RAND sought answers to two key questions. First, would the NRO benefit from building modular satellites? RAND researchers developed a method for evaluating whether a system is a good candidate for modularity and applied it to systems both inside and outside the NRO. The authors found that NRO space systems do not appear to be strong candidates for modularization. Second, what lessons might be drawn from how chief executive officers, military personnel, and health care professionals (among others) respond to surprise? RAND developed a framework to categorize professionals' responses to surprise and then conducted discussions with representatives from 13 different professions, including former ambassadors, chief executive officers, military personnel, and physicians. The authors observed that all interviewees used common coping strategies. The authors also found some differences in response to surprise that depend on two factors: time available to respond and the level of chaos in the environment. The report concludes with recommendations on actions that the NRO can take to improve the flexibility of its hardware and the workforce.

"Space is now a congested, contested, and competitive environment. Space systems must become more resilient to potential adversary actions and system failures, but changes to space systems are costly. To provide a complete look at resilience and possibly realize some benefit at lower cost, the Air Force asked RAND to identify non-materiel means--doctrine, organization, training, leadership and education, personnel, facilities, and policy--to enhance space resilience over the near and far terms. The authors developed implementation options to improve resilience based on a notional space protection operational concept: enhancing the capability of space operators to respond, in a timely and effective manner, to adversary counterspace actions. Operators need actionable information, appropriate organization and tactics, and dynamic command and control, supported by appropriate tools and decision aids, relevant training and exercises, and qualified personnel brought into the career field. The authors also recommend that Air Force Space Command develop a formal, end-to-end, space protection concept of operations (CONOPS) that captures all elements needed to improve resilience. In addition, the CONOPS could potentially follow the tenet of centralized control and decentralized execution in certain situations, such as when responding to adversary counterspace actions. For the near-term options, the rough order of magnitude (ROM) nonrecurring engineering (NRE) cost of implementation is estimated to be between $2.5 million and $3.6 million. For the far-term options, the ROM NRE cost is estimated to be between $109 million and $166 million, with the ROM recurring cost between $4 million and $5.4 million per year"--Publisher's description.
